Dry rot repair services focus on identifying and eliminating fungal decay caused by certain types of wood-destroying fungi. This process typically involves thorough assessment of affected areas to determine the extent of damage, followed by the removal of compromised wood materials. After removing the decayed sections, specialists often treat the remaining wood and surrounding structures to prevent future fungal growth. The goal is to restore the integrity of the affected structures and prevent further deterioration that could compromise safety or stability.
This service addresses common problems associated with dry rot, including weakened wooden components, structural instability, and potential safety hazards. If left untreated, dry rot can spread rapidly, affecting load-bearing beams, framing, and other wooden elements. It may also lead to costly repairs if the damage progresses unnoticed. Professional dry rot repair helps contain the fungus, remove affected materials, and implement measures to prevent recurrence, ultimately preserving the property's structural soundness.

The overview below groups typical Dry Rot Repair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Marshfield, MA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Initial Inspection and Assessment - Typically costs range from $200 to $500 for a thorough evaluation of dry rot damage, including identifying affected areas and determining repair needs.
Surface Repair and Treatment - Repair costs for minor surface treatments usually fall between $500 and $1,500, depending on the extent of the rot and the materials used.
Structural Repairs and Replacement - Replacing or reinforcing structural components can range from $2,000 to $10,000 or more, based on the size of the affected area and complexity of the work.
Preventive Measures and Sealants - Applying sealants or preventative treatments generally costs between $300 and $800, aimed at reducing future moisture intrusion and rot development.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is dry rot, and how does it affect my property? Dry rot is a type of fungal decay that damages wood, causing it to weaken and crumble, which can compromise the structural integrity of buildings.
How can a professional repair dry rot? Local service providers typically assess the affected area, remove and replace damaged wood, and treat surrounding areas to prevent future fungal growth.
What are common signs of dry rot in a building? Signs include spongy or crumbly wood, a musty odor, discoloration, and visible fungal growth or cracking in wooden structures.
